$images_dir = 'images/';
如果我希望我的图像目录文件是当前目录,我将替换images / with。谢谢。
其次,如果我有一个脚本gallery.php,它将目录中的所有图像转换为图库。我有大约20个目录,我想变成一个画廊。有没有办法让gallery脚本在每个目录中工作,而不必在每个目录中都有脚本。例如,在每个具有index.php脚本的目录中
call yourdomain.com/gallery.php
或沿着这些方向
谢谢!
目录配置
1.photos
2.group photos
3.1
3.2
3.3
3.etc
2.single photos
3.1
3.2
3.3
3.etc
2.etc
答案 0 :(得分:1)
您可以使用
获取当前目录 getcwd();
参考:http://in2.php.net/manual/en/function.getcwd.php
dirname(__FILE__);
参考:http://in2.php.net/manual/en/function.dirname.php#21138
basename(__DIR__)
参考http://in1.php.net/manual/en/function.basename.php
您可以使用$ _GET获取目录名作为查询参数并呈现相应的页面,而不是在您的调用看起来像每个目录中都有脚本
call yourdomain.com/gallery.php?id=XXX